全文搜索
标题搜索
全部时间
1小时内
1天内
1周内
1个月内
默认排序
按时间排序
为您找到相关结果3,920个

PHP PDOStatement对象bindpram()、bindvalue()和bindcolumn之间的区别_p...

PDOStatement::bindParam — 绑定一个参数到指定的变量名。 绑定一个PHP变量到用作预处理的SQL语句中的对应命名占位符或问号占位符。 不同于 PDOStatement::bindValue() ,此变量作为引用被绑定,并只在 PDOStatement::execute() 被调用的时候才取其值。 PDOStatement::bindValue — 把一个值绑定到一个参数。 绑...
www.jb51.net/article/576...htm 2024-5-11

bindParam和bindValue的区别以及在Yii2中的使用详解_php实例_脚本之家

bindParam() 和 bindValue() 非常相似。唯一的区别就是前者使用一个 PHP 变量绑定参数, 而后者使用一个值。对于那些内存中的大数据块参数,处于性能的考虑,应优先使用前者。根据id查询一条数据,并对id进行过滤:1 2 3 $id = 1; $result = Yii::$app->db->createCommand("select * from product where id=...
www.jb51.net/article/1362...htm 2024-5-16

pdo中使用参数化查询sql_php技巧_脚本之家

pdo中使用参数化查询sql 方法bindParam() 和 bindValue() 非常相似。 唯一的区别就是前者使用一个PHP变量绑定参数,而后者使用一个值。 所以使用bindParam是第二个参数只能用变量名,而不能用变量值,而bindValue至可以使用具体值。 复制代码代码如下: $stm = $pdo->prepare("select * from users where user = :...
www.jb51.net/article/279...htm 2024-6-1

PHP处理Oracle的CLOB实例_php技巧_脚本之家

分享给大家供大家参考。具体方法如下: 1. 写入数据 在使用PDO的预处理方法时,如果使用bindParam()等而不指定字段的数据类型或使用execute(),PDO都会默认为string类型,并且限定一个默认长度 所以在存clob类型字段时必须使用bindParam()或bindValue()等,并指定字符串长度,例如: 复制代码代码如下: $pdo -> bindParam...
www.jb51.net/article/570...htm 2024-5-20

PHP数据库链接类(PDO+Access)实例分享_php实例_脚本之家

function Read($sql,$params=array()) { $bind=$this->conn->prepare($sql); $arrKeys=array_keys($params); foreach($arrKeys as $row) { $bind->bindValue(":".$row,$params[$row]); } $bind->execute() or die('sql error:'.$sql); ...
www.jb51.net/article/441...htm 2024-5-11

PHP PDO函数库详解_php技巧_脚本之家

PDOStatement->bindValue() — Binds a value to a parameter PDOStatement->closeCursor() — Closes the cursor, enabling the statement to be executed again. PDOStatement->columnCount() — Returns the number of columns in the result set PDOStatement->errorCode() — Fetch the SQLSTATE associated ...
www.jb51.net/article/232...htm 2024-6-1

PHP高级编程实例:编写守护进程_php技巧_脚本之家

$sth->bindValue(':volume',$this->data[2]); $sth->execute(); $sth= null; /* ... */ $update="UPDATE fee SET `status` = 'Y' WHERE ticket = :ticket and `status` = 'N'"; $sth=$dbh->prepare($update); $sth->bindValue(':ticket',$this->data[0]); $sth...
www.jb51.net/article/546...htm 2024-6-1

PDO预处理语句PDOStatement对象使用总结_php实例_脚本之家

PDOStatement::bindValue — 把一个值绑定到一个参数 PDOStatement::closeCursor — 关闭游标,使语句能再次被执行。 PDOStatement::columnCount — 返回结果集中的列数 PDOStatement::debugDumpParams — 打印一条 SQL 预处理命令 PDOStatement::errorCode — 获取跟上一次语句句柄操作相关的 SQLSTATE ...
www.jb51.net/article/576...htm 2024-6-2

小文件php+SQLite存储方案_php技巧_脚本之家

$stmt->bindValue(1, $contents, SQLITE3_BLOB); $stmt->execute(); 读数据文件:php2.php 复制代码代码如下: <?php $pdo = new SQLite3('mysqlitedb.db'); $results = $pdo->query('select * from person'); while ($row = $results->fetchArray()) { ...
www.jb51.net/article/247...htm 2024-5-22

在Qt中操作MySQL数据库的实战指南_Mysql_脚本之家

方式二:bindValue() 直接用自定义的名称来完成绑定,这时绑定顺序可以自己决定。 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 QSqlQuery query; query.prepare("insert into student (id,name,age,math) values (:id,:name,:age,:math)");//:id之类的名字时自定义的 自己方便就好 ...
www.jb51.net/article/2799...htm 2024-6-2